WebSep 27, 2024 · In a saucepan combine the water, vinegar, honey, red pepper flakes and salt. Bring to a boil over high heat. In a jar pack the onion and garlic. Pour the hot vinegar mixture over the onion. Put the lid on and leave to cool. Refrigerate for at least 2 days before eating. Store in the fridge for up to 1 month. WebFeb 22, 2024 · Add the prepared garlic to a clean glass jar that has a lid. Pour 1 to 1 ½ cup of raw, unpasteurized honey over the garlic, just enough to completely cover the garlic and not much more.
